The UX Designer will own design work for features within the Love's mobile app (iOS and Android), contributing to visual, interaction, and experience design while collaborating with cross-functional teams throughout the process. Responsibilities also include contributing to the component library/design system and creating design artifacts from wireframes to polished specifications.

Responsibilities

  • Design intuitive, accessible, and visually consistent experiences for the Love's mobile application
  • Contribute to the evolution of the team's component library and design system
  • Create design artifacts across fidelity levels, from rough wireframes and flows to polished, fully annotated specs ready for development handoff

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field: Interaction Design, Visual Communications, Graphic Design, HCI, Psychology, Computer Science, or equivalent practical experience
  • 3+ years of UX/product design experience, with demonstrated mobile design work
  • A portfolio showcasing process and craft, with mobile app work strongly preferred

About Love's Travel Stops & Country Stores

Founded in 1964 by Tom Love, Love’s Family of Companies is headquartered in Oklahoma City, and remains entirely family-owned and operated. With more than 600 locations in 42 states, Love’s approximate growth rate is 40 stores per year. From the first filling station in Watonga, Oklahoma, the Love’s commitment has remained the same: “Clean Places, Friendly Faces.” Love’s was founded on the values of integrity, Customer focus, strong work ethic, innovation and perseverance. Tom Love displayed all of these as he built Love’s from the ground up – from one small filling station in western Oklahoma in 1964 to more than 550 Love’s locations coast to coast. These core values are the keys to our success. But Tom didn’t do it by himself. He surrounded himself with visionary team members who embodied the same set of values.
